DESCRIPTION:Mulch Minion Festival \nThe Mulch Minion Festival returns on Monday 29th September. Held annually in the cane fields of the Gold Coast\, this much-loved community event transforms sugar cane mulch bales into colourful Minion-themed sculptures\, creating a trail of fun for families to discover during the school holidays. \nResidents\, community groups\, and local businesses take part by crafting imaginative Minion figures from sugar cane mulch and other materials. These creations are then displayed along a designated trail through the cane fields and surrounding suburbs\, including Yatala\, Stapylton\, Jacobs Well\, and Norwell. Families can drive or walk the route to spot each Minion\, making it an interactive way to explore the region while enjoying some holiday fun. \nA trail map showing all Minion locations will be released closer to the date\, so visitors can plan their adventure and experience the full display of creativity on show. \nMulch Minion Festival event details \nWhen: Monday 29th September to Monday 6th October 2025 \nWhere: Various locations around the northern Gold Coast \nCost: Free \nMore information: Mulch Minion Festival  \n\n\n\n

DESCRIPTION:Brisbane 100: One City Together\nBrisbane City Hall will come alive for the Brisbane 100 celebrations\, a free family event marking 100 years of Greater Brisbane. Running from 10am to 4pm\, the day offers something for all ages\, with plenty to keep kids entertained. \nChildren can enjoy hands-on workshops with Bazil Grumble\, puzzles from Just Wood Fun\, and interactive activities from the Museum of Brisbane\, including “Brisbane Now and Then.” A scavenger hunt with prizes will add to the fun\, making it a day of discovery and excitement. \nFor families wanting to explore more\, guided tours with Brisbane Greeters and the Museum of Brisbane offer a chance to see City Hall and even climb the iconic clock tower. Historic photos\, displays\, and storytelling sessions will bring Brisbane’s past to life\, while celebrating the city’s diverse community and vibrant culture. \nBrisbane 100: One City Together event details\nWhen: Wednesday 1 October 2025\, 10am – 4pm \nWhere: Brisbane City Hall\, Adelaide St\, Brisbane City 4000 \nCost: Free entry for all ages \nMore information: Brisbane 100: One City Together

DESCRIPTION:Moon Festival Fortitude Valley\nThe Moon Festival\, also known as the Mid-Autumn Festival\, is one of the most cherished and auspicious dates on the Asian calendar. Traditionally celebrated when the moon is at its fullest\, it symbolises reunion\, family\, and the sharing of mooncakes. \nThis year\, Fortitude Valley will once again come alive with colour\, music\, and tradition as the Moon Festival returns! From spectacular lion and dragon dances to Japanese drumming\, martial arts displays\, and roving performances\, the Valley will be brimming with entertainment\, culture\, and community spirit. \nVisitors can also explore food\, drink\, and market stalls in Chinatown Mall\, take part in craft workshops\, enjoy live stage performances\, and discover roving acts bringing the legends of the Moon Festival to life throughout the precinct. With something happening around every corner\, it’s a celebration not to be missed. \nMake the night even more special by booking a table at one of the Valley’s top Asian restaurants. Whether you’re craving a traditional banquet or a modern twist on classic flavours\, it’s the perfect chance to indulge while soaking up the festive atmosphere. \nHighlights include: \n\nLion and dragon dances across the precinct\nJapanese drumming\, martial arts\, and live music\nTheatrical performances inspired by Moon Festival folktales\nClay mooncake and lantern craft workshops\nMarket stalls and authentic Asian dining\n\nCelebrate culture\, community\, and connection under the glow of the full moon – right here in the heart of Fortitude Valley. \nMoon Festival Fortitude Valley event details \nWhen: Saturday 4th October\, from 2pm \nWhere: Chinatown Mall\, Duncan St\, Fortitude Valley  \nCost: Free entry  \nMore information: Moon Festival Fortitude Valley
